| I haven't done any scrapbooking, but my teenage granddaughter tried her hand at it for a Christmas gift and did a lovely job. I'd like to get her a subcription to a scrapbooking magazine. I saw several offered on eBay, but I don't know which to pick. I figured you folks could steer me in the right direction.
Thanks! Susan |

| I subscribe to Simple Scrapbooks and find a lot of good ideas in it. I have a softcover book that I refer to everytime I work on a page--Creating Keepsakes, A Treasury of Favorites. Title: Scrapbook Tips and Techniques. $16.96 I got it at Michael's with a 40% off coupon. I'll be watching this thread for more ideas. Have fun with your granddaughter and her scrapbooking projects. |

| Hi, I have found a great magazine called Scrapbook Answers. Each issue comes with a great CD with a ton of fonts and ideas to download for free. The magazine itself is great but the CD makes it even better. I have found it at Walmart and Michaels. Enjoy. |
